Procurement has shortlisted three candidates: Korven Moulding, Astrabright Components, and Pellworth Industrial. Sample runs begin next month, with qualification testing expected to take eight weeks. Please avoid signalling any change to customers until qualification completes, as pricing and lead times remain uncertain. The strategic rationale behind this dual-sourcing push is summarised below.

board note of yadup-fajef: Druiusox Holdings is in early talks to buy Norwynek Systems for about $186.0 million. The Kaseth launch date is June 24, and nothing goes to the press before then. Legal wants the Quenethek Group term sheet withdrawn before November 27.

# Artifact Signing — Pickwright Optimizer

All Pickwright pick-list optimizer builds must be signed before the warehouse nodes will load them. Unsigned artifacts are quarantined and the nodes fall back to the last verified build, which can cause stale routing during peak shifts. If you see quarantine alerts, verify the artifact signature manually before escalating. Verification uses the current release signing key, recorded below.

signing key of kahog-kadup = bky13_6wLyxnPsJob4P

CI note: Flitline websocket reconnect flake

The reconnect test in the Flitline gateway suite fails ~15% of runs on shared runners. Root cause: the test asserts reconnect within 2s, but runner CPU contention delays the backoff timer. Not a product bug — confirmed stable on dedicated runners. Short-term fix merged: assertion window widened to 5s and jitter seeded deterministically. Keep an eye on the nightly soak; if reconnect storms reappear, bisect from last week's gateway bump. Failing runs can be matched using the trace token below.

pipeline stamp: htk9_ce63042d9